Datacentre Storage Planning In modern datacentre design, storage forms one of the major parts of the infrastructure. There are a large number of components which must be considered in design, including:
- Free-standing arrays.
- High density array planning.
- SAN switch and fabric design.
- SAN cabling and patching.
- Tape library planning.
- Network storage appliances.
A number of issues must be considered:
- Weight, especially with high density arrays.
- Cable management and patching.
- Growth planning and management.
- Cooling.
- Power provisiong.
